Transaction 758938bd75b1f9795ca35a707e4b3002d9219636d3b73005183db89e90d23299
1 Input
1 Output
-
758938bd75b1f9795ca35a707e4b3002d9219636d3b73005183db89e90d23299:0
- value
- 76900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 00faf7e4ce2a195e7cf0661b8a875f9e59139ecb OP_EQUAL
- address
- 31nCa8TU4xhGuvihwnUTMQnPfmuvgGMaRv